Onychopapilloma Presenting as Longitudinal Erythronychia in an Adolescent.

Sarah Beggs1, Niraj Butala2, Warren R Heymann2,3, Adam I Rubin3.   

Abstract

We report a case of pediatric onychopapilloma that presented with monodactylous longitudinal erythronychia. Pediatric dermatologists should be aware that this rare, benign nail unit tumor can occur in children. Clinicians should recognize its clinical and histologic presentation and be cognizant of management options.
